Output 5d1b72f81c120681e0dfee234d5626450dd40c326bcf53ccca76aa9b98117fc6:0

value
249568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ea01e16f78b4f04db8f2b92761deae3c2563a670 OP_EQUAL
address
3P2LJ6h7nN69MemT57mZfNMm8PQYkZytQb
transaction
5d1b72f81c120681e0dfee234d5626450dd40c326bcf53ccca76aa9b98117fc6
confirmations
358125
spent
true